| 1 | Endoscopic ultrasound-guided biliary drainage with placement of a fully covered metal stent for malignant biliary obstruction显示文摘AIM:To determine the utility of endoscopic ultrasoundguided biliary drainage(EUS-BD)with a fully covered self-expandable metal stent for managing malignant biliary stricture. METHODS:We collected data from 13 patients who presented with malignant biliary obstruction and underwent EUS-BD with a nitinol fully covered selfexpandable metal stent when endoscopic retrograde cholangiopancreatography(ERCP)fails.EUS-guided choledochoduodenostomy(EUS-CD)and EUS-guided hepaticogastrostomy(EUS-HG)was performed in 9 patients and 4 patients,respectively. RESULTS:The technical and functional success rate was 92.3%(12/13)and 91.7%(11/12),respectively. Using an intrahepatic approach(EUS-HG,n=4),there was mild peritonitis(n=1)and migration of the metal stent to the stomach(n=1).With an extrahepatic approach(EUS-CD,n=10),there was pneumoperitoneum(n=2),migration(n=2),and mild peritonitis (n=1).All patients were managed conservatively with antibiotics.During follow-up(range,1-12 mo),there was re-intervention(4/13 cases,30.7%)necessitated by stent migration(n=2)and stent occlusion(n=2). | 2 | Effect of focal laser photocoagulation in eyes with mild to moderate non-proliferative diabetic retinopathy显示文摘AIM:To report the effect of focal laser photocoagulation on both the severity of hard exudates(HEs) and the rate of disease progression in eyes with mild to moderate non-proliferative diabetic retinopathy(NPDR).METHODS: We retrospectively reviewed the medical records of 33 patients(60 eyes) who had been diagnosed with mild to moderate NPDR between January 2006 and December 2012.The patients were divided into 2 groups:Group A(38 eyes in 20 patients treated using focal laser photocoagulation) and Group B(treated without laser photocoagulation).We also reviewed the best corrected visual acuity measurements,and the fundus photographs taken at both baseline and follow-up visits. RESULTS: In Group A,HE severity grade had decreased significantly from baseline to the final visit(P <0.05),but this was not the case in Group B(P =0.662).The cumulative probabilities of retinopathy progression at 5y were 26% in Group A and 30% in Group B.KaplanMeier survival curves showed no significant difference between the groups with regard to retinopathy progression(P =0.805).CONCLUSION: Focal laser photocoagulation reduced the levels of HEs in eyes with mild to moderate NPDR.However,the treatment was not able to decelerate the progression of DR. | Seong Hun Jeong Jung Il Han Sung Won Cho Dong Won Lee Chul Gu Kim Tae Gon Lee Jong Woo Kim | 2016 | International Journal of Ophthalmology(English edition)2016,9,10: | 10 |

| 12 | Ultrasensitive and Highly Stretchable Multiple‑Crosslinked Ionic Hydrogel Sensors with Long‑Term Stability显示文摘Flexible hydrogels are receiving significant attention for their application in wearable sensors.However,most hydrogel materials exhibit weak and one-time adhesion,low sensitivity,ice crystallization,water evaporation,and poor self-recovery,thereby limiting their application as sensors.These issues are only partly addressed in previous studies.Herein,a multiplecrosslinked poly(2-(methacryloyloxy)ethyl)dimethyl-(3-sulfopropyl)ammonium hydroxide-co-acrylamide)(P(SBMA-co-AAm))multifunctional hydrogel is prepared via a one-pot synthesis method to overcome the aforementioned limitations.Specifically,ions,glycerol,and 2-(methacryloyloxy)ethyl)dimethyl-(3-sulfopropyl)ammonium hydroxide are incorporated to reduce the freezing point and improve the moisture retention ability.The proposed hydrogel is superior to existing hydrogels because it exhibits good stretchability(a strain of 2900%),self-healing properties,and transparency through effective energy dissipation in its dynamic crosslinked network.Further,2-(methacryloyloxy)ethyl)dimethyl-(3-sulfopropyl)ammonium hydroxide as a zwitterion monomer results in an excellent gauge factor of 43.4 at strains of 1300-1600%by improving the ion transportability and achieving a strong adhesion of 20.9 kPa owing to the dipole-dipole moment.The proposed hydrogel is promising for next-generation biomedical applications,such as soft robots,and health monitoring. | Jin‑Young Yu Seung Eon Moon Jeong Hun Kim Seong Min Kang | 2023 | Nano-Micro Letters2023,15,4: | 0 |
